. The championships are generally held in mid-November and the host nation rotates every year between the Nordic countries. Established in 1997, the championships comprises four separate races: the men's senior and junior competitions (9 kilometres and 6 km respectively), and a senior and junior competition for women (7.5 km and 4.5 km). The women's senior race was previously the same length as the junior race, but this was modified in 2008. The distances are approximate and vary slightly from year to year depending on the course. In addition to the individual competitions, each race doubles as a team competition in which the finishing positions of the top three athletes from each country are combined, with the lowest scoring national team winning. The performances of the top four athletes are used for the men's senior team race.Nieminen, Mikko (2004-11-14)
